700 Series - RC Terminator Networks
Electrical Characteristics - Resistors
Standard Resistance Range, ±5 % Tolerance ............................22 ohms to 470K ohms
Operating Voltage ................................................................................ 50 volts maximum
Electrical Characteristics - Capacitors
Capacitance Range ...........................................................................39 pF to 47,000 pF
Capacitance Range ................................................................. 470 pF to 47,000 pF X7R
Capacitance Range ........................................................................ 39 pF to 470 pF NPO
Capacitance Tolerance ...........................................................................................±20 %
Operating Temperature...........................................................................-30 °C to +85 °C
Voltage Rating ......................................................................................................50 volts
Physical Characteristics
Flammability .................................................................................. Conforms to UL94V-0
Lead Frame Material .....................................................................Copper, solder coated
Body Material ...........................................................................................Conformal coat
